#if NET_2_0
namespace System.Web.Security
{
[Serializable]
public class MembershipUser
{
string providerName;
string name;
object providerUserKey;
string email;
string passwordQuestion;
string comment;
bool isApproved;
bool isLockedOut;
DateTime creationDate;
DateTime lastLoginDate;
DateTime lastActivityDate;
DateTime lastPasswordChangedDate;
DateTime lastLockoutDate;
protected MembershipUser ()
{
}
public MembershipUser (string providerName, string name, object providerUserKey, string email,
string passwordQuestion, string comment, bool isApproved, bool isLockedOut,
DateTime creationDate, DateTime lastLoginDate, DateTime lastActivityDate,
DateTime lastPasswordChangedDate, DateTime lastLockoutDate)
{
this.providerName = providerName;
this.name = name;
this.providerUserKey = providerUserKey;
this.email = email;
this.passwordQuestion = passwordQuestion;
this.comment = comment;
this.isApproved = isApproved;
this.isLockedOut = isLockedOut;
this.creationDate = creationDate.ToUniversalTime ();
this.lastLoginDate = lastLoginDate.ToUniversalTime ();
this.lastActivityDate = lastActivityDate.ToUniversalTime ();
this.lastPasswordChangedDate = lastPasswordChangedDate.ToUniversalTime ();
this.lastLockoutDate = lastLockoutDate.ToUniversalTime ();
}
void UpdateSelf (MembershipUser fromUser)
{
try { Comment = fromUser.Comment; } catch (NotSupportedException) {}
try { creationDate = fromUser.CreationDate; } catch (NotSupportedException) {}
try { Email = fromUser.Email; } catch (NotSupportedException) {}
try { IsApproved = fromUser.IsApproved; } catch (NotSupportedException) {}
try { isLockedOut = fromUser.IsLockedOut; } catch (NotSupportedException) {}
try { LastActivityDate = fromUser.LastActivityDate; } catch (NotSupportedException) {}
try { lastLockoutDate = fromUser.LastLockoutDate; } catch (NotSupportedException) {}
try { LastLoginDate = fromUser.LastLoginDate; } catch (NotSupportedException) {}
try { lastPasswordChangedDate = fromUser.LastPasswordChangedDate; } catch (NotSupportedException) {}
try { passwordQuestion = fromUser.PasswordQuestion; } catch (NotSupportedException) {}
try { providerUserKey = fromUser.ProviderUserKey; } catch (NotSupportedException) {}
}
internal void UpdateUser ()
{
MembershipUser newUser = Provider.GetUser (name, false);
UpdateSelf (newUser);
}
public virtual bool ChangePassword (string oldPassword, string newPassword)
{
bool success = Provider.ChangePassword (UserName, oldPassword, newPassword);
UpdateUser ();
return success;
}
public virtual bool ChangePasswordQuestionAndAnswer (string password, string newPasswordQuestion, string newPasswordAnswer)
{
bool success = Provider.ChangePasswordQuestionAndAnswer (UserName, password, newPasswordQuestion, newPasswordAnswer);
UpdateUser ();
return success;
}
public virtual string GetPassword ()
{
return GetPassword (null);
}
public virtual string GetPassword (string answer)
{
return Provider.GetPassword (UserName, answer);
}
public virtual string ResetPassword ()
{
return ResetPassword (null);
}
public virtual string ResetPassword (string answer)
{
string newPass = Provider.ResetPassword (UserName, answer);
UpdateUser ();
return newPass;
}
public virtual string Comment {
get { return comment; }
set { comment = value; }
}
public virtual DateTime CreationDate {
get { return creationDate.ToLocalTime (); }
}
public virtual string Email {
get { return email; }
set { email = value; }
}
public virtual bool IsApproved {
get { return isApproved; }
set { isApproved = value; }
}
public virtual bool IsLockedOut {
get { return isLockedOut; }
}
public bool IsOnline {
get {
return LastActivityDate > DateTime.Now - TimeSpan.FromMinutes (Membership.UserIsOnlineTimeWindow);
}
}
public virtual DateTime LastActivityDate {
get { return lastActivityDate.ToLocalTime (); }
set { lastActivityDate = value.ToUniversalTime (); }
}
public virtual DateTime LastLoginDate {
get { return lastLoginDate.ToLocalTime (); }
set { lastLoginDate = value.ToUniversalTime (); }
}
public virtual DateTime LastPasswordChangedDate {
get { return lastPasswordChangedDate.ToLocalTime (); }
}
public virtual DateTime LastLockoutDate {
get { return lastLockoutDate.ToLocalTime (); }
}
public virtual string PasswordQuestion {
get { return passwordQuestion; }
}
public virtual string ProviderName {
get { return providerName; }
}
public virtual string UserName {
get { return name; }
}
public virtual object ProviderUserKey {
get { return providerUserKey; }
}
public override string ToString ()
{
return UserName;
}
public virtual bool UnlockUser ()
{
bool retval = Provider.UnlockUser (UserName);
UpdateUser ();
return retval;
}
MembershipProvider Provider {
get {
MembershipProvider p = Membership.Providers [ProviderName];
if (p == null) throw new InvalidOperationException ("Membership provider '" + ProviderName + "' not found.");
return p;
}
}
}
}
#endif
